Comparing Window Tinting Options in 2023

The Benefits of Window Tinting

Window tinting is one of the most popular ways to customize your vehicle in 2023. Window tinting offers many benefits such as reducing glare, blocking UV rays, and providing privacy. In addition, window tinting can improve the look of your car, adding a sleek and modern look to it. Window tinting can also help keep the interior of your car cooler, reducing the need for air-conditioning and saving you money in the long run.

Types of Window Tinting

When it comes to window tinting, there are several different types to choose from. The most popular types are dyed, metallic, ceramic, and hybrid tints. Each type has its own advantages and disadvantages, so it’s important to understand the differences between them before making a decision.

Dyed Tinting

Dyed tinting is the most common type of tinting, and it is the least expensive option. It is created by adding a dye to the tinting film, which blocks the UV rays by absorbing them. The downside to dyed tinting is that it can fade over time. It is also not as effective at blocking heat as other types of tinting.

Metallic Tinting

Metallic tinting is the next step up from dyed tinting. It is created by adding tiny metallic particles to the tinting film. These particles act as a heat shield, blocking the heat from entering the car. The downside to metallic tinting is that it can cause interference with radio and cell phone signals. It also tends to be more expensive than dyed tinting.

Ceramic Tinting

Ceramic tinting is the most advanced type of tinting available. It is created by adding ceramic particles to the tinting film. These particles are designed to reflect the heat away from the car, making it the most effective type of tinting for blocking heat. The downside to ceramic tinting is that it is the most expensive option and it can be difficult to install.

Hybrid Tinting

Hybrid tinting is a combination of the different types of tinting. It is created by combining the benefits of dyed, metallic, and ceramic tinting. Hybrid tinting provides superior heat and UV protection while still being relatively inexpensive. The downside to hybrid tinting is that it can be more difficult to install than the other types of tinting.

Choosing the Right Window Tinting for You

When it comes to window tinting, there is no one-size-fits-all solution. You will need to decide which type of tinting is best for you based on your needs, budget, and preferences. If you are looking for the best protection from the sun and heat, ceramic tinting is the way to go. If you are looking for a more affordable option, then hybrid tinting may be the best choice. Ultimately, the choice is up to you.
